WebSo, by the chain rule, g ∘ f(x) = xtAx is differentiable and d(g ∘ f)x(h) = dgf ( x) ∘ dfx(h) = dg ( x, x) (h, h) = xtAh + htAx. This is true for any matrix A. Now if A is symmetric, this can be simplified since xtAh + htAx = xtAh + htAtx = xtAh + (Ah)tx = 2xtAh. WebFind derivative of x x: Medium Solution Verified by Toppr Let y=x x Applying log on both sides logy=xlogx Differentiating wrt x y1dxdy=logx+ x1×x dxdy=y(1+logx) dxdy=x … WebSep 7, 2024 · Find the derivative of f(x) = cscx + xtanx. Solution To find this derivative, we must use both the sum rule and the product rule. Using the sum rule, we find f′ (x) = d dx(cscx) + d dx(xtanx). In the first term, d dx(cscx) = − cscxcotx, and by applying the product rule to the second term we obtain d dx(xtanx) = (1)(tanx) + (sec2x)(x).
